Add a burst of vibrant color and extended bloom time to your garden with the Echinacea purpurea 'Prairie Splendor', commonly known as the Prairie Splendor Coneflower. This herbaceous perennial is renowned for its striking pinkish-purple petals surrounding a distinctive coppery-orange central cone, offering a captivating display from early summer through fall.
Key Features:
- Height: 18-24 inches (45-60 cm)
- Spread: 18-24 inches (45-60 cm)
- Flower Color: Bright pinkish-purple with a coppery-orange cone
- Bloom Time: Early summer to fall, boasting a longer blooming period compared to most coneflowers
- Sun Requirements: Thrives in full sun
- Soil Preferences: Prefers well-drained soil but is adaptable to various soil types including clay, loamy, and sandy soils
- Water Needs: Moderate; drought-tolerant once established
- Hardiness Zones: USDA zones 3-9
Benefits:
- Extended Blooming Season: Enjoy a prolonged floral display that brightens up your garden from early summer through the fall.
- Low Maintenance: Requires minimal care, making it perfect for gardeners seeking easy-to-grow plants.
- Drought Tolerant: Well-suited for xeriscaping and water-wise gardening.
- Pollinator Friendly: Attracts butterflies, bees, and other beneficial insects, contributing to a healthy garden ecosystem.
- Wildlife Friendly: Seed heads provide a food source for birds during winter.
- Deer Resistant: Generally not preferred by deer, reducing the risk of damage.

Care Instructions:
- Pruning: Deadhead spent flowers to encourage continuous blooming and prevent self-seeding. Cut back in late fall or early spring to tidy up the plant.
- Propagation: Easily propagated by seeds or division in spring or fall.
